This policy explains what personal data we collect, why we collect it, who we share it with, and what control you have over it.
What we collect
- Name, delivery address, PIN code — to deliver your order
- Email address — order confirmation, tracking and support replies
- Mobile number — delivery updates and courier contact
- Order history — to handle returns, refunds and support queries
- Payment reference (transaction or UTR number) — to confirm and reconcile your payment
- IP address, browser and device type — security, fraud prevention and analytics
What we do not collect
We never see or store your card number, CVV, UPI PIN or bank password. Payments are handled entirely by our payment partners on their own secure systems. We receive only a success or failure result and a transaction reference.
You can shop without creating an account. We do not require you to register, and we do not store passwords for customers.
How we use your data
- To process, pack, deliver and invoice your order
- To contact you about your order
- To handle returns, refunds and customer support
- To detect and prevent fraudulent orders
- To meet our tax and accounting obligations
- To send marketing email — only if you opted in, and you can unsubscribe at any time
We do not sell your personal data, and we do not rent or trade our customer list.
Who we share it with
- Payment gateways — to process payments and refunds
- Courier partners — your name, address and phone number, to deliver your parcel
- Email provider — to send order confirmations and updates
- Hosting provider — which stores the site and its database
- Government authorities — where we are legally required to disclose
Cookies and analytics
Essential cookies keep your shopping bag and session working and cannot be turned off without breaking the site. We also use analytics and advertising tools to understand how the site is used; these may set their own cookies. Embedded videos from Instagram and YouTube load only when you choose to play them, so their trackers are not set unless you do.
How long we keep it
Order and invoice records are kept for as long as tax and accounting law requires. Marketing contact details are kept until you unsubscribe.
Your rights
You can ask us for a copy of your data, to correct it, to delete it where we are not required to keep it, or to stop sending you marketing email. Email us and we will respond within 30 days. We may ask you to confirm your identity first.
Children
Our products are not directed at children and we do not knowingly collect data from anyone under 18.
